Transaction 6939018871ceef1571916058e17b4af24bd42c30d6294d29f2cd8ae9d56495d0

4 Input
2 Outputs
  • 6939018871ceef1571916058e17b4af24bd42c30d6294d29f2cd8ae9d56495d0:0
  • value  16904
    address  3JKZNfQqMWVKdEeXkbgsp1TGsrrSPNnrov
  • 6939018871ceef1571916058e17b4af24bd42c30d6294d29f2cd8ae9d56495d0:1
  • value  8686520
    address  3QHygNgyEepXhCEFnPZqSNFe3GPmbSDPNu